Tumor autophagy is associated with survival outcomes in patients with resected non-small cell lung cancer
•The importance of autophagy in non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C).•Increased number of stone like structures (SLSs), detected by LC3A immunohistochemistry is associated with poor overall and disease free survival outcomes in patients with NSCLC.•LC3A mRNA expression is also a negative prognostic ma...
